Transaction 28ad63171af68c3c986cba26ef9415e35e7c0ea120973aba8adebd73d4e1e528
1 Input
1 Output
-
28ad63171af68c3c986cba26ef9415e35e7c0ea120973aba8adebd73d4e1e528:0
- value
- 73773317
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d50109d1182e936476448719fadeb2d5c93b937 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JFzdGE3AnR3cU9umHg5jbaaR9RkQfEbHt